Yes, Denver could see Christmas day snow – Here’s how much

Dec 23, 2024, 3:16 PM | Updated: Dec 27, 2024, 6:40 am

Depending on what your definition of a “white Christmas” is, we may get one in Denver this year…

Our partners at 9News say that although the storm won’t be very impressive, Christmas night may be a white one in Denver.

They say that the Denver metro area could see a flip from rain to snow on Christmas night. The winter storm will bring a potential for a bit of slushy accumulation on Christmas night into Thursday morning. Totals will probably not be more than an inch or two, but parts of the Denver area could have a few slick spots on roads, especially on the Palmer Divide and southern foothills where it’ll be a bit colder.

Most mountain ranges in western Colorado a good 3 to 8 inches of snow, with a few locally higher totals.
